I am trying install an old printer on an old computer.  What should have
been a piece of cake has turned into a quagmire.  The printer is a Canon
BJC-210.  The error I am getting is 'Print Position of Cleaning Fault/ (10
beeps).  What can be done to reset the cleaning mechanism?  Be mindful that
I have pieced this together as a charity case, so spending money my last
option.

Thanks in advance

J

 
 
 

Canon BJC-210 Cleaning Error

Post by Steve Wilk » Tue, 27 Nov 2001 01:25:29


There is a position sensor on the back of the carriage sensor this has
either come out or has broken off completely, unfortunately this means
calling out a technician, parts for this printer are now quite scarce but
can still be obtained. If you are in the UK it will cost 88.12 to get a
technician to your door.
